Output e157d60c7881d28fb6a325cdd792052a30ec0dd5af41aea78a14a1830547a631:0

value
83398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84426afdf31181b437465c8e8100aa9e726d4e44 OP_EQUAL
address
3DkLgfVrdmFRke1L1xVtWLFYfgeV7zuZBp
transaction
e157d60c7881d28fb6a325cdd792052a30ec0dd5af41aea78a14a1830547a631
spent
true